Partager via


Vue d'ensemble du modèle de contenu d'un objet Panel

Mise à jour : novembre 2007

Cette vue d'ensemble de modèle de contenu décrit le contenu pris en charge pour un Panel. StackPanel et DockPanel représentent des exemples d'objets Panel.

Cette rubrique comprend les sections suivantes.

  • Propriété du contenu de l'objet Panel
  • Utilisation de la propriété Enfant
  • Types partageant ce modèle de contenu
  • Types pouvant contenir des objets Panel
  • Rubriques connexes

Propriété du contenu de l'objet Panel

Un objet Panel contient les propriétés de contenu suivantes.

Utilisation de la propriété Enfant

La propriété Children peut contenir plusieurs objets, même d'autres objets Panel. L'exemple suivant montre comment utiliser la propriété Children pour ajouter deux objets Button à StackPanel.

<Page  xmlns="https://schemas.microsoft.com/winfx/2006/xaml/presentation"
  xmlns:x="https://schemas.microsoft.com/winfx/2006/xaml">
  <StackPanel>
    <Button>Button 1</Button>
    <Button>Button 2</Button>
  </StackPanel>
</Page>
using System;
using System.Windows;
using System.Windows.Controls;

namespace SDKSample
{
    public partial class StackpanelExample : Page
    {
        public StackpanelExample()
        {
            // Create two buttons
            Button myButton1 = new Button();
            myButton1.Content = "Button 1";
            Button myButton2 = new Button();
            myButton2.Content = "Button 2";

            // Create a StackPanel
            StackPanel myStackPanel = new StackPanel();

            // Add the buttons to the StackPanel
            myStackPanel.Children.Add(myButton1);
            myStackPanel.Children.Add(myButton2);

            this.Content = myStackPanel;
        }
    }
}

Types partageant ce modèle de contenu

Les classes suivantes héritent de la classe Panel.

Types pouvant contenir des objets Panel

Consultez Modèle de contenu WPF.

Voir aussi

Concepts

Vue d'ensemble de Panel